POSITION DUTIES
This position serves as the
Executive Associate I within the Division of Educator Certification and Program
Approval (DECPA) and is responsible for providing administrative support to the
Assistant State Superintendent of the Division, the Professional Standards and
Teacher Education Board, the Certification Review Board/Reinstatement Review
Panel, and to the DECPA as a whole. This
position provides technical support, leadership, and office management to the
DECPA support staff while also serving as the financial representative assigned
to the DECPA. This position uses knowledge, skills and experience in word
processing, editing, and proofreading; in accessing information from the
Maryland State Department of Education's policy and procedures manual; in
office organization and management, and interpersonal skills.
Position Responsibilities
include:
- Independently responsible for the coordination of administrative coverage of DECPA
- Prioritizing key projects and routine work of the Division
- Maintenance of the Division’s web page
- Responsible for ensuring the Division telephone line and certification assistance line are always answered during business hours
- Provide executive assistance and support to the Assistant State Superintendent
- Coordination of Division workflow
- Preparation of correspondence entailing knowledge of the Department’s and Division’s procedures, functions and policies for the review and signature of the Assistant State Superintendent
- Manage and work with confidential materials
- Represent and carry out the functions of the Human Resources Partner, Property Control and Inventory Officer, and Executive Team Support Officer for the Division
- Act as an intermediary for the public, with professional personnel within the Division, Branches, and the Assistant State Superintendent
- Consult with Division’s Financial Representative in administering the financial needs of the Division
- Prepare the Division’s budget, purchase orders, Notice of Grant Awards, invoices, consultant forms and travel requests
- Serve as the Administrative Assistant for the Professional Standards and Teacher Education Board (PSTEB)
- Serve as the Administrative Assistant for the Certification Review Board (CRB)
- Coordinates the preparation of all the Divisions mandated report requirements
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
Experience: Seven years of experience in administrative or
professional work.
Note:
- Candidates may substitute possession of an Associate’s degree for 2 years of the required experience.
- Candidates may substitute possession of a Bachelor’s degree for 4 years of the required experience.
- Candidates may substitute U.S. Armed Forces military service experience a non-commissioned officer involving staff work requiring regular use of independent judgement and analysis in applying and interpreting rules and regulations in accordance with agency laws and policies on a year-for-year basis for the required education and experience.
